What is a Chunk Roast?

If you’ve ever wondered what a chunk roast is, you’re in the right place! A chunk roast, also known as a chuck roast, is a cut of beef that comes from the shoulder area of the cow. It’s known for its rich flavor and tender, juicy texture when cooked properly. This cut is perfect for slow cooking, allowing the meat to break down and become melt-in-your-mouth delicious.

Ingredients for a Perfect Chunk Roast

Before you dive into cooking, gather these ingredients to ensure your chunk roast turns out perfectly:

  • 3-4 lbs chunk roast
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 large onion, chopped
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 3 carrots, peeled and chopped
  • 3 celery stalks, chopped
  • 2 cups beef broth
  • 1 cup red wine (optional)
  • 2 tablespoons tomato paste
  • 2 bay leaves
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Preparing Your Chunk Roast

Preparation is key to a successful chunk roast. Here’s what you need to do:

  1. Trim the Roast: Remove any excess fat from the roast.
  2. Season Generously: Rub the roast with salt, pepper, and your favorite seasonings.
  3. Let it Sit: Allow the roast to come to room temperature before cooking.

Different Cooking Methods for Chunk Roast

There are several methods to cook a chunk roast, each bringing out different flavors and textures. We should examine some of the top choices available:

Chuck Roast Recipes in Oven

Baking your chunk roast in the oven is a classic method that yields tender, juicy results. Here’s how to do it:

  1. Preheat Your Oven: Set it to 325°F (165°C).
  2. Sear the Roast: In a large oven-safe pot, heat olive oil over medium-high heat and sear the roast on all sides until browned.
  3. Add Vegetables and Liquids: Add onions, garlic, carrots, celery, beef broth, red wine, tomato paste, bay leaves, and thyme.
  4. Bake: Cover the pot and bake in the preheated oven for 3-4 hours or until the meat is tender.

Chuck Roast Recipes Stove Top

Cooking a chunk roast on the stove top is another fantastic method. Here’s how to do it:

  1. Sear the Roast: In a large, heavy-bottomed pot, heat olive oil over medium-high heat and sear the roast on all sides until browned.
  2. Add Vegetables and Liquids: Add onions, garlic, carrots, celery, beef broth, red wine, tomato paste, bay leaves, and thyme.
  3. Simmer: Bring to a boil, then reduce the heat to low, cover, and simmer for 3-4 hours, stirring occasionally, until the meat is tender.

Slow Cooker Chunk Roast

Using a slow cooker is a hands-off approach that ensures your roast is tender and flavorful:

  1. Sear the Roast: Just like the oven method, start by searing the roast.
  2. Transfer to Slow Cooker: Place the roast in the slow cooker and add the remaining ingredients.
  3. Cook on Low: Set the slow cooker to low and cook for 8-10 hours.

Instant Pot Chunk Roast

For a quicker method, the Instant Pot is your best friend:

  1. Sear the Roast: Use the sauté function to brown the roast on all sides.
  2. Add Ingredients: Add the vegetables and liquids.
  3. Pressure Cook: Seal the lid and set the Instant Pot to high pressure for 60 minutes. Let it naturally release pressure for 15 minutes before opening.

Best Seasonings for Chunk Roast

The right seasoning can make all the difference. Below are some top choices:

  • Garlic and Herb: Use fresh garlic, rosemary, thyme, and oregano.
  • Spicy Kick: Add paprika, cayenne pepper, and chili flakes.
  • Simple and Savory: Just salt, pepper, and a touch of olive oil.

Serving Suggestions for Chunk Roast

Chunk roast is incredibly versatile and pairs well with a variety of side dishes. Here are some ideas:

With Mashed Potatoes

A classic pairing! The creamy texture of mashed potatoes complements the rich, beefy flavor of the roast.

With Roasted Vegetables

Roasted vegetables like carrots, potatoes, and Brussels sprouts make a healthy and delicious side.

With Gravy

Make a quick gravy using the pan drippings. Simply whisk in some flour and beef broth until it reaches your desired consistency.

Tips and Tricks for the Best Chunk Roast

Choosing the Right Cut

Look for a chunk roast with good marbling. The fat will render down during cooking, adding flavor and tenderness to the meat.

Marinating for Extra Flavor

If you have time, marinate the roast overnight. Infusing the meat will enhance its flavor even further.

Using a Meat Thermometer

To ensure your roast is cooked perfectly, use a meat thermometer. Aim for an internal temperature of 145°F (63°C) for medium-rare, 160°F (71°C) for medium, and 170°F (77°C) for well done.
